Commandment #2. Set Realistic Weight Loss Goals.

Your "target weight" must be based in reality, not fantasy. If you're trying to look like Barbie or Ken (or Pamela Anderson or "Arnold,") you are in Fantasyland--and in danger as well. Make your goal to be healthy...not "perfect."

Commandment #8. Have A Realistic Time Frame

Trying to lose more than 1-2 pounds per week sets you up to get sick, to fail, to be miserable, and probably all of the above. "Losing 10 pounds in 2 days" is very unlikely and very unhealthy. You didn't put on your unwanted pounds in a hurry. Don't try to take them off that way.
